A dominant offensive performance paired with a steady outing in the circle propelled the Monticello Sages to a convincing 10-0 victory over Maroa-Forsyth in five innings.
Monticello wasted no time seizing control, erupting for a four-run first inning that set the tone for the afternoon. The Sages strung together a series of extra-base hits, including doubles from Reese Stiger, Ali Weidner, and Madison Highland, while Isabella Beery delivered an RBI single to cap the early surge. By the end of the frame, Monticello had built a commanding lead and never looked back.
The offense continued to roll in the third inning, where Monticello added three more runs. A triple from Isabella Beery and another big hit from Madison Highland highlighted the rally, extending the advantage to 7-0. The Sages’ aggressive approach at the plate kept constant pressure on Maroa-Forsyth’s defense.
Monticello put the finishing touches on the game in the fourth inning with another three-run outburst. Cassidee Stoffel delivered a key triple, driving in multiple runs, while additional hits throughout the lineup pushed the lead to double digits and triggered the run rule after five innings.
The Sages finished with 10 runs on nine hits, showcasing balance from top to bottom in the lineup. Beery led the way with three hits and three RBIs, while Stoffel added two RBIs and Highland contributed a pair of hits and an RBI. Weidner and Stiger also chipped in with multi-base hits as part of the offensive explosion.
In the circle, Madison Highland was in control from the start. The right-hander tossed five innings of one-hit softball, allowing no runs while striking out one and walking three. Highland worked efficiently and relied on solid defense behind her to keep Maroa-Forsyth off the scoreboard.
Defensively, Monticello was sharp, turning a key double play and limiting mistakes throughout the game. The clean performance complemented the strong pitching effort and ensured there would be no momentum shift.
